Virginia Beach - Charity Louise Campbell, 89, died October 9, 2015 after a brief illness. She was born to Everett Messer and Lillian Tinkham Messer in Passadumkeag, ME on August 17, 1926.

She was predeceased by her husband of 67 years, Robert L. Campbell, and their son, Mark E. Campbell.

She leaves behind her sister, Maxine Quackenbush (Jack), and brother, Samuel Messer (Kathy), of Rochester, NY; her sons, Michael (Rose) of Virginia Beach, and Matthew (Shelley) of San Antonio, TX; twelve grandchildren: Jason (Danielle), Jennifer, Tracy, Charity, Mark Joseph, Francis, Brian, Maeve, Evan, Elizabeth (Jesse), Robert, and Sandra; and eleven great-grandchildren.

Charity lived a full and productive life, devoting herself to her family and community. She ensured that a home was maintained throughout a number of military postings that Robert was assigned throughout his career in the United States Air Force. Charity was actively involved in numerous school functions and organizations throughout the boys' school years. She was an active member of the Norfolk Valley of Scottish Rite Ladies and a past member of the Order of the Eastern Star.
